Identify Your Spending plan

Establishing a budget is an important action in the apartment or condo hunting procedure. This financial structure allows prospective tenants to efficiently narrow their choices and avoid overspending. Renters need to initially analyze their month-to-month income, making sure that real estate expenses do not exceed 30% of their profits. Furthermore, it is crucial to represent relevant expenses such as energies, net, and maintenance costs, which can significantly influence total affordability.To develop a sensible spending plan, individuals are urged to evaluate their existing economic commitments, including fundings and cost savings goals. This assessment will aid clarify what they can reasonably assign toward lease. Possible tenants must take into consideration potential rent increases and the accessibility of rental insurance policy. By establishing a clear spending plan, apartment hunters can make educated choices, eventually resulting in an extra rewarding rental experience. Mindful financial planning is the keystone of effective apartment hunting.

Understand Lease Terms



Before signing a lease, it is essential for renters to thoroughly take a look at the conditions detailed in the contract. Understanding the lease period is vital, as it defines the rental period and any kind of charges for very early termination. Tenants should likewise keep in mind the payment schedule, including due dates and approved payment methods. The lease may consist of clauses concerning protection deposits, maintenance duties, and pet dog plans, which can substantially influence living arrangements.Renters need to be mindful of any guidelines regarding home alterations or subleasing, as these can restrict personal freedom. In addition, it is essential to examine revival alternatives and rent out increase terms, guaranteeing clearness on future financial responsibilities. Finally, comprehending the eviction procedure and conditions under which it may happen can shield occupants from unexpected scenarios. A detailed review of lease terms makes it possible for occupants to make educated choices and helps prevent misconceptions in the future.
